Patient safety is a system that prevents the occurence of undesirable events (KTD). One of the undesirable events in hospital is phlebitis caused by infusion. The purpose of this research is to identify the relationship between application international patient safety goals 5 (IPSG 5) with the incidence of phlebitis in hospital. This research is descriptive study with prospective approach. The samples were taken from the nursing ward III and patients with infusion in ward III room of Arifin Achmad Hospital Riau Province with 91 respondents. The sampling technique is total sampling. The data is collected by questionnaire that already tested for validity by the value of r count ranging from 0.513 up to 0.830 and 0.943 reliability with r results as well as the installation documentation of infusion therapy. The data is analyzed by univariate and bivariate with Chi- square test. The results show p value was 0,00 (α < 0,05), that there is significantly relationship between nurse behavior of application international patient safety goals 5 (IPSG 5) with incidence of phlebitis. It is suggested that nurse need to make a documentation note of infusion and observe the infusion to minimize the occurrence of phlebitis.
